top of page

What are the System Requirements for Odoo POS Integration?

  • Writer: Caret IT
    Caret IT
  • Jan 21
  • 4 min read

Odoo POS integration can significantly enhance the operational efficiency of retail businesses. But before you begin integrating Odoo with your point of sale (POS) system, it's crucial to ensure that your infrastructure meets the necessary system requirements. These requirements vary depending on the scale of your operations, the number of users, and your specific needs for customization.

This article breaks down the essential system requirements for Odoo POS integration, focusing on the hardware and software prerequisites that will ensure a seamless integration experience. Whether you are located in Belgium or anywhere else, meeting these requirements will help maximize the effectiveness of your Odoo POS system.

1. Hardware Requirements for Odoo POS: For the Odoo POS integration to run efficiently, you need suitable hardware. Below are the key hardware components you should consider:

1.1. Computers and Devices:

  • PC/Tablet: Odoo POS is primarily web-based, so any device with a modern web browser will work. This includes computers and tablets. For larger operations, a PC with at least 4GB of RAM and a dual-core processor is ideal. Tablets should have at least 2GB of RAM and a stable internet connection.

  • Touchscreen Monitors: Since Odoo POS is designed for touch-based interactions, a touchscreen monitor is recommended. Ensure it has good resolution and responsiveness, especially for quick order-taking.

1.2. Barcode Scanners: A barcode scanner is essential for quick product identification and checkout processes. USB and Bluetooth barcode scanners are supported by Odoo, but make sure the scanner is compatible with your POS system.

1.3. Receipt Printers: Odoo POS requires a thermal receipt printer. Make sure the printer is supported by Odoo’s integration system and can easily connect to your device. USB and network printers are commonly used.

1.4. Cash Drawers: A cash drawer is used to store cash during transactions. Odoo POS integrates with most standard cash drawers, ensuring it opens automatically when a transaction is completed.

2. Software Requirements for Odoo POS Integration:To ensure your Odoo POS system runs smoothly, meeting the software requirements is just as important as hardware compatibility.

2.1. Operating System:

  • Server-Side: For hosting Odoo, a Linux-based server (Ubuntu, Debian, or CentOS) is recommended. However, Odoo can also be installed on Windows or macOS for smaller-scale operations.

  • Client-Side: The POS client (whether on a desktop, laptop, or tablet) should run on an operating system with support for modern browsers. This includes Windows 10, macOS, or Linux-based systems.

2.2. Odoo Version: Make sure you are using the latest stable version of Odoo. Odoo releases updates regularly, adding new features and improving performance. Check that the version of Odoo you’re using is compatible with your chosen POS hardware.

2.3. Web Browser: Since Odoo POS operates within a web browser, ensure that the browser is up-to-date and fully supports modern web technologies. The following browsers are recommended:

  • Google Chrome (latest version)

  • Mozilla Firefox (latest version)

  • Microsoft Edge (latest version)

3. Database and Hosting Requirements: For optimal performance, your Odoo POS integration should be hosted on a server capable of handling your business’s database.

3.1. Database: Odoo uses PostgreSQL as its database management system. Ensure that your server supports PostgreSQL and that it is properly configured to handle the data load from your POS system.

3.2. Cloud Hosting: For seamless scalability, consider using cloud hosting services like AWS, Google Cloud, or a local provider in Belgium. Cloud hosting offers flexibility in scaling up your resources as your business grows.

3.3. Storage: A minimum of 20GB of available storage is recommended for storing Odoo’s data and logs. As your business grows, more storage may be required to accommodate a larger database.

4. Internet and Network Requirements: Since Odoo POS is a cloud-based system, a stable internet connection is critical for its operation.

4.1. Internet Speed: To ensure smooth performance, your internet connection should have a minimum speed of 10 Mbps for a single user. For larger teams or high-traffic environments, 100 Mbps or higher is recommended.

4.2. Network Security: Ensure that your POS system is protected by a firewall and that sensitive customer data is encrypted during transmission. For businesses operating in Belgium, make sure your network adheres to GDPR standards for data protection.

5. Integration with Third-Party Systems: Odoo POS integrates with various third-party applications, such as accounting software, e-commerce platforms, and CRM systems. The following integrations are common:

  • Accounting Systems: Ensure your POS system can integrate with accounting software like QuickBooks, Xero, or Odoo’s own accounting module.

  • Payment Gateways: Odoo POS can integrate with various payment gateways such as Stripe, PayPal, and traditional card payment systems. Ensure your payment terminal supports the integration you choose.

6. Customization Needs:If you require custom features or specific functionalities in your Odoo POS system, you may need additional customization. This could involve hiring an Odoo developer or working with a certified Odoo partner to meet your unique business needs.

7. Technical Support and Maintenance: While Odoo POS is relatively easy to set up, ongoing support and maintenance are crucial for keeping your system running smoothly. Make sure you have access to technical support for troubleshooting and regular updates to avoid downtime.

Conclusion: Odoo POS integration can transform your retail operations by streamlining sales processes and improving customer service. By meeting the right hardware, software, and network requirements, you’ll ensure that your Odoo POS system runs effectively. Whether you're running a small retail shop or a large enterprise, adhering to these requirements will give you a seamless experience.

 
 
 

Comments


bottom of page